Abstract

This study aimed to describe the analysis of problem posing students in terms of taxonomy bloom. Mathematical material that is chosen is a square and a triangle. This study used a qualitative approach with descriptive research. This study was conducted in one of the SMP Negeri Malang, with research subjects IX class consisting of 32 students. Researchers gave math tests to be analyzed based on blooms taxonomy, and researcher mengkategorisasikannya by high-level thinking skills or Higher Order Thinking Skills (HOTS) and low-level thinking skills or Lower Order Thinking Skills (LOTS). The results of this study indicate that: (1) 96.875% of the 32 students to questions categorized remembering, understanding, and applying, therefore the students included LOTS. (2) there is one category of students including analyzing, it means the student has included HOTS.
